BJP Govt Has Never Banned Any Media Outlets : Rajnath Singh

Referring to the 1951 revision of Article 19, he claimed that the Congress administration had even changed the Constitution to restrict free expression

Rajnath Singh, the union defence minister, stated on Sunday that those who claim that press freedom has been violated forget that the BJP's governments have not banned any media outlets or restricted anyone's freedom of speech.

Referring to the 1951 revision of Article 19, he claimed that the Congress administration had even changed the Constitution to restrict free expression.

Singh said that a discussion about freedom of expression has reopened in the nation while speaking at a summit hosted by the RSS mouthpiece Panchjanya.

He added that the intriguing thing is that individuals who claim that there has been a breach of media freedom today forget whether it was Atalji's government or Modiji's government.  They did not place any restrictions on anyone's freedom of speech or expression, nor did they ban any media outlets.

Attacking the Congress, he claimed that there had been numerous instances of various freedoms being violated during the long history of the grand old party.

Even the Constitution had been altered by the Congress government to limit free expression. He said that people who live in glass houses shouldn't cast stones at others.
